Veggie Pita Pizzas
Veggie Pita Pizzas is an easy dinner. Made with 2 (6-inch) pita bread rounds, 1/2 (8 oz.) can herbed or plain tomato sauce, 1 c. cooked vegetables (such as broccoli, mushrooms, cauliflower, green pepper, asparagus or green beans) and 1/2 c. shredded part skim mozzarella cheese,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. Split each pita bread round horizontally so you have four rounds.
Place rounds on baking sheet.
Bake in a 450° oven for 2 to 3 minutes or until dry and crisp.
Spread each round with tomato sauce.
Arrange vegetables on top.
Sprinkle with Mozzarella cheese.
Bake in 450° oven about 5 minutes or until cheese melts and pizzas are heated through.
